Why Does Bleeding Happen During Motion?
Bleeding usually happens when there is damage or swelling in the anal canal. The most common reasons include:
Piles (haemorrhoids)
Anal fissure
Constipation and hard stools
Infection or inflammation
Less common but serious conditions such as polyps or rectal disease
Proper examination is the best way to confirm the cause.
Bleeding Due to Piles (Haemorrhoids)
Piles are swollen blood vessels in the anal area. When stool passes, these veins may bleed. In many piles cases:
Bleeding is bright red
Blood appears on tissue paper or in the toilet
Pain may be mild or absent in early stages
Itching or swelling may be present
Internal piles often cause painless bleeding, which is why many patients delay treatment.
Bleeding Due to Anal Fissure
Anal fissure is a small tear in the lining of the anus. It usually causes:
Sharp pain during and after motion
Burning sensation for hours
Fresh bleeding (small quantity)
Fear of using the toilet due to pain
Fissure bleeding is usually accompanied by severe pain, unlike piles.
When Bleeding Is a Warning Sign
You should consult a specialist urgently if you notice:
Heavy bleeding
Bleeding for more than a few days
Weakness or dizziness
Black stool or very dark blood
Fever, pus discharge, or swelling
Weight loss or loss of appetite
Do not self-medicate, because the real cause may get missed.
How the Condition Is Diagnosed
Diagnosis usually includes:
Medical history discussion
Physical examination
Proctoscopy or anoscopy if required
Other tests in selected cases
Accurate diagnosis ensures the correct and safest treatment plan.

Prevention Tips to Stop Bleeding in Future
Avoid constipation
Do not strain during motion
Eat fiber-rich foods daily
Drink enough water
Exercise regularly
Avoid sitting for long hours without breaks
These habits reduce pressure on anal veins and help prevent piles recurrence.
